Hi Everyone,

I joined the group a while a go but haven't been able to follow along and research the files as I have needed to. I was referred by a friend who is a member of the Specific Carbohydrate group. My little boy is physically and mentally impaired due to a genetic deletion called 1p36. Anyway, like most special needs kids, he suffers from gut issues that trigger seizures and interfer with his development. He is 3 yrs old but developmentally about 5 months old. He started having gut issues at 2 months because of the formula I was told to give him. That's when he had his first seizure and those turned into Infantile Spasms. After 3 yrs of this, I know his seizures are triggered by abnormal eliminations, whether his stools are too loose or too hard.

I am totally exausted. I thought we had a good routine going but his stools got loose, triggering seizures again. So I increased the good fats in his diet to help with that. Stools firmed up almost immediately for about 2 weeks and I thought we were good. He was laughing and smiling again with no seizures. Now he is constipated and seizures are back...ugh....! We are up to about 370 mg of magnesium. He gets 1 cap of Magnesium citrate(170mg) and 200mg from his powder vitamin.

He used to take a prune/orange juice combo every morning but now he mostly refuses it. I also stopped the cod liver oil because I thought he may be intolerant to one of the ingredients but now I don't now.

I'm an emotional wreck because of this constant roller coaster and could really use some direction. There is so much information and I feel like I've done everything I know to do except concede defeat and put him on Miralax like all of the other 1p36 kids. He has never been on medication, and I'm trying so hard to get him to go naturally. But these seizures disrupt EVERYTHING and I don't know how much more I can hold out.

Your help would be greatly appreciated.

Ronette ( 3 yrs, 1p36 Chromosome Deletion Syndrome)

Hello Ronette. So sorry to hear about what you are going through. My heart bleeds for you.

What worked for my DD was a combination of probiotics (Good Start formulas, originally Nestle) and in her cereals (Good Belly Cereals) and a daily dose of Vitamin C Gummy Vites by Vitafusion. Initially, we had to administer Fleet's glycerine enema if she hadn't gone by the 3rd day, but we had to do that only 3 or 4 times.

For us, milk with lactose was the culprit. She is doing well on organic lactose-free milk now.

I do hope you do not have to resort to Miralax. For my DD, it caused failure to thrive (she didn't gain any weight or grow in height for the duration she was on Miralax - 8.5 months) and behavioral issues as well as some tics that have thankfully gone away.

I wish you the best of luck.
